Mining contributes to escalating global concerns regarding water pollution and human health. This study investigates major ions and potentially toxic elements (PTEs) in water sources around a limestone quarry for irrigation suitability and public health. Samples were analyzed using standard methods and assessed with established pollution, ecological, and health risk models. pH values ranged from 2.61 to 8.16, indicating acidic to slightly alkaline waters. Calcium and HCO 3 were the dominant ions, with Mg-HCO 3 as the prevailing water type. Most parameters are within the WHO guidelines, except for pH, As, Cr, Ni, and Pb in some samples. Irrigation indices SAR (<10), MAR (4.37 – 25.89 %), KR (0.06 – 0.37 %), Na% (5.16 – 16.57), and PS (43.38 – 162.75) suggest overall suitability, though elevated potential salinity (PS up to 162.75) suggested possible long-term soil salinization. Pollution indices (CF, Igeo, PN) showed low to moderate contamination, and ecological risk (PERI = 39.45) was classified as low. However, human health risk assessment revealed ingestion as the dominant exposure pathway, with As and Pb posing carcinogenic and neurotoxic risks, and Cr and Ni showing genotoxic and reproductive toxicity potential. Treatment is recommended before domestic or industrial use. The findings highlight the need for continuous monitoring, quarry waste water management, and community health surveillance. Integrating hydrochemical data with adaptive water quality governance supports sustainable resource use and aligns with SDG 6 (Clean Water) and SDG 15 (Life on Land).
